Ingredients

Pasta

  • 400 g spaghetti

Garlic Prawns

  • 400 g Medium Green Australian Prawns, Peel and Devein
  • 4 - 5 cloves garlic
  • 30 g olive oil
  • 80 g Butter
  • 1 - 2 tbsp dried chilli flakes
  • 1 zest of a lemon
  • 30 g fresh lemon juice
  • 6 sprigs fresh parsley, leaves only, roughly chopped
  • sea salt and cracked pepper

Recipe's preparation

    Pasta
  1. Cook Pasta on stove top for 8 - 10min or in your Thermoserver until al dente. 

  2. Garlic Prawns
  3. Place the garlic in the mixing bowl and chop 3 sec/speed 7. Scrape down sides of mixing bowl with spatula. 

    Add the olive oil, butter, dried chilli flakes, and the zest of one lemon. Cook for 2 min/100/speed 1.

    Add the prawns to the mixing bowl and cook for 2-3min/100/Counter-clockwise operation"Counter-clockwise operation" /speed Gentle stir setting"Gentle stir setting" .

    Once your pasta is cooked drain and place in your serving dish or Thermoserver, add all of the prawn mixture over the pasta, then add the lemon juice, chopped parsley, salt and pepper and toss to combine. 

    Serve with some crusty rustic bread to soak up all that sauce. 

    Enjoy!

Tip

Add more or less chilli and lemon according to your taste tmrc_emoticons.-)

    If you are using a Thermomix® TM6 measuring cup with your Thermomix® TM5:
    For cooking (simmering) at temperatures of 95°C or above (200°F), the simmering basket should always be used instead of the TM6 measuring cup, as the TM6 measuring cup fits tightly in the lid. The simmering basket rests loosely on top, is steam-permeable, and also prevents food spatter from the mixing bowl.
    Please note that the TM5 mixing bowl has a larger capacity than the TM31 (capacity of 2.2 liters instead of 2.0 liters for TM 31). Recipes for the Thermomix TM5 may not be cooked with a Thermomix TM31 for safety reasons without adjusting the quantities. Risk of scalding by spraying of hot liquids: Do not exceed the maximum filling quantity and observe the filling level markings of the mixing bowl!
